Understanding Xbox Download Speeds

Before diving into the troubleshooting process, it’s essential to understand what affects download speeds on your Xbox. Various factors can impact how quickly games and updates are downloaded, including:

  • Internet Connection Speed: The speed of your broadband connection plays a significant role in download times. Higher speeds generally lead to faster downloads.
  • Network Congestion: If multiple devices are using the same network, it can slow down your Xbox downloads.
  • Server Issues: Sometimes, slow downloads are due to problems with Xbox Live servers, especially during peak times.
  • Hardware Limitations: The performance of your Xbox itself, including storage capacity and system updates, can affect download speeds.

Step-by-Step Process to Improve Xbox Download Speeds

If you are facing slow download speeds on your Xbox, follow these steps to potentially improve your experience:

1. Check Your Internet Connection

The first step is to test your internet connection speed. You can do this by:

  • Using a speed test website on another device connected to the same network.
  • Checking the Xbox’s built-in network test feature:

To do this, go to Settings > General > Network settings, and select Test network speed & statistics.

2. Optimize Your Network Settings

After checking your connection, consider the following optimizations:

  • Use Wired Connection: A wired Ethernet connection is often faster and more stable than a wireless one.
  • Change DNS Settings: Switching to a public DNS like Google DNS (8.8.8.8) or OpenDNS can sometimes enhance download speeds.
  • Limit Bandwidth Usage: Ensure that other devices on your network aren’t using excessive bandwidth. You can pause or disconnect them during downloads.

3. Update Your Xbox System

Ensure your Xbox is running the latest software version. Regular updates can improve performance and fix bugs that may slow down downloads:

  • Go to Settings > System > Updates.
  • If an update is available, download and install it.

4. Manage Storage Space

Low storage space can affect your console’s performance. Free up space by:

  • Deleting games you no longer play.
  • Moving games to an external hard drive if your internal storage is full.

Troubleshooting Slow Xbox Downloads

If you’ve tried the above steps and are still experiencing slow download speeds, consider the following troubleshooting tips:

1. Restart Your Xbox and Router

A simple restart can often resolve temporary connectivity issues:

  • Turn off your Xbox completely and unplug it for a minute.
  • Restart your router by unplugging it for 30 seconds.
  • Once both devices are back on, try downloading again.

2. Check Xbox Live Status

Sometimes the issue lies with Xbox Live servers. Visit the Xbox Live Status page to check for any service interruptions.

3. Change Your Download Queue Settings

You can prioritize downloads by adjusting the settings:

  • Go to Settings > System > Updates.
  • Make sure your console is set to automatically download updates and manage game installations efficiently.

4. Enable Instant-On Mode

Enabling Instant-On mode allows your Xbox to download updates while in sleep mode:

  • Go to Settings > General > Power mode & start-up.
  • Select Instant-On to enable it.
